    ELMER T. MEHRING

    Elmer T. Mehring, 69, Harrisburg, formerly of Littlestown, for many years owner and operator of The Merchants-Grocery Company, Harrisburg, died Saturday evening at a hospital there. He was an active member for many years at the Second Evangelical and Reformed Church, that city.

    Surviving are three sisters, Miss Bertha F. Mehring, Baltimore; Mrs. Rufus Hartman and Mrs. Calvin Shanebrook, both of Harrisburg.

    Funeral services were held in the Harry S. Fisher funeral home, 1334 North Second street, Harrisburg, Wednesday at 11 a.m. with The Rev. Henry S. Raab, pastor of the Second Evangelical and Reformed Church officiating. Burial in the Mt. Carmel Cemetery, Littlestown at 2 p.m.

    The Gettysburg Times
    Gettysburg, Pennsylvania
    Jun 16, 1944
